Output 24db218e7f54469d3cd88b4c20a17a2e726ee4df123c427e564fd57049392a19:0

value
1697700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ca864a6ac22784cb239c1fd1f4e9a553aa3daa OP_EQUAL
address
3CRqbeBjaHe1HLqkDgzZ6CBkA3QjJrH7qj
transaction
24db218e7f54469d3cd88b4c20a17a2e726ee4df123c427e564fd57049392a19
confirmations
268825
spent
true